What Causes This Problem
- Fire sprinkler activation releases large amounts of water rapidly indoors.
- Old or rusty sprinkler heads can break causing unexpected water discharge.
- Electrical faults can cause false alarms triggering the sprinkler system.
- Fire suppression can leave corrosive residue needing professional cleaning.
- Mechanical failure in the system sometimes causes accidental sprinkler activation.

Our Work Process
- Inspect affected areas and evaluate the extent of fire sprinkler water damage.
- Contain and remove excess water using industry-standard extraction equipment.
- Clean surfaces to remove corrosion and disinfect to prevent mold growth.
- Monitor drying progress with moisture meters to ensure thorough cleanup.
- Perform final inspections and recommend preventative measures for sprinkler system care.
